Surviving the holiday period
How to ensure staff taking summer holidays doesn't interfere with your business
The summer months – and August in particular – is peak holiday season as staff take well-earned breaks in warmer climes and coincide breaks with school holidays.
But for entrepreneurs struggling to run a business during difficult economic conditions, ensuring the company can still function on a reduced staff is no easy matter. Staff absence at client organisations can also have an impact, for example on your ability to get paid for goods received or services performed. Full story >
